Marsupial gardeners
Article Abstract:
Musky Rat-kangaroos or 'Hypsis' are considered to be the sole extant members of the family Hypsiprymnodontidae and the smallest members of the kangaroo super family, Macropodoidea. Musky Rat-kangaroos are one of only three frugivores that are able to disperse fruits of all sizes and bury seeds throughout the forest.
